[
Login
] [
Register
]
|
Contact us
|
中文
Home
Search Parts
Vehicle
Product
Member
Suppliers
Hot Searches
0446535290
0449230160
05142555AA
05174001AA
1571571
1571572
3C0698451A
425085
4F0698451G
5191271AC
or
Post Buying Request
Suppliers
DELCO REMY
DSP2810
Find The OE Number:
034 145 159 LX
LAUBER
55.2810
Find The OE Number:
034 145 159 LX